#516763 Color
#516763 is rgb(81, 103, 99) in RGB, hsl(169, 12%, 36%) in HSL, and about cmyk(21%, 0%, 4%, 60%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Feldgrau (#4D5D53),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.8.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#516763 Channel Values
How #516763 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 81 · G 103 · B 99 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 169° · S 12% · L 36%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 169° · S 21% · V 40%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 21% · M 0% · Y 4% · K 60%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 6.05:1 vs white · 3.47: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#516763 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#516763 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#516763?
#516763 is a dark green — rgb(81, 103, 99) in RGB and hsl(169, 12%, 36%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Feldgrau (#4D5D53),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.8.
What is the RGB value of #516763?
#516763 is rgb(81, 103, 99) — red 81, green 103, and blue 99 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#516763?
#516763 converts to approximately cmyk(21%, 0%, 4%, 60%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#516763 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#516763 scores 6.05:1 against white and 3.47: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#516763 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#516763 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is dimgray (#696969) at a CIE76 distance of 9.64,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
